"Founded by Tommy Perse (father of T-shirt mogul James), Maxfield is where Larry David should have gone shoe shopping on Curb Your Enthusiasm. Maxfield is a place to see and be seen, but it's also a place to indulge in strange fashion and design fantasies that can't be fulfilled anywhere else. It's famous for introducing L.A. to Comme des Garçons and Yohji Yamamoto in the early '80s and somewhat infamous for selling a selection of shrunken heads alongside vintage Birkins a few decades later."

GQ's Guide to Los Angeles, the Best Shopping City in America
